Hiiden hirvi is a mythical great elk, that is found in folk poetry.
@Aurinkohirvi6 жыл бұрын
Hiisi means sacred. It's connected to sacred groves and cemetaries. Christianity perverted Finnish pagan age words and concepts into devil worshipping, since pagan gods equalled devil to Christians. Thus the Finnish pagan sky god, Perkele/Piru now equals Devil to most Finns, only people who know of their pagan history know the origin of the words. Thus Perkele/Piru is the same deity worshipped by the Balts and the Slavs also, Perun and Perkunas by their names.
